What may be the complementary relationship, in terms of employment, between illegal fruit pickers and domestic-born truck drivers?

Complementary Relationship

A situation where two goods or services are used together, and the increase in consumption of one leads to an increase in consumption of the other.

Illegal Fruit Pickers

Individuals who are employed in agricultural harvesting without legal authorization or documentation.

Domestic-born Truck Drivers

Truck drivers who are born within the country they are working, as opposed to those who have immigrated.

Final Answer :
As with legal immigrants, some illegal workers are complementary inputs to domestic-born workers, not substitutes. An example is the illegal fruit pickers and the domestic-born truck drivers who deliver the fruit to grocery stores. The lower price of the fruit increases the amount of fruit demanded and thus the amount of it that needs to be delivered. As a result, the labor demand increases for the complementary truck drivers whose wage rates rise.
